Coffee and Oat Smoothie with Coconut Milk Recipe

A creamy, vegan, energizing smoothie blending oats, coffee, and coconut milk for a quick, sassy breakfast or snack.
Prep Time 5 minutes
Total Time 5 minutes
Servings 2 servings
Calories 210 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• Rolled oats – ½ cup
  • Brewed coffee chilled – 1 cup
  • Coconut milk – 1 cup
  • Banana ripe, medium – 1
  • Maple syrup – 1 tbsp optional
  • Vanilla extract – ½ tsp
  • Cocoa powder – 1 tsp optional, for flavor
  • Ice cubes – 4–6

Instructions
 

  • Add ½ cup rolled oats to the blender.
  • Pour in 1 cup chilled brewed coffee and 1 cup coconut milk.
  • Add 1 ripe banana for sweetness and creaminess.
  • Sweeten with 1 tbsp maple syrup if desired.
  • Drop in ½ tsp vanilla extract for aroma.
  • Sprinkle 1 tsp cocoa powder for depth of flavor.
  • Add 4–6 ice cubes for chill.
  • Blend until smooth and frothy.
  • Pour into tall glasses.
  • Sip immediately while pretending life is under control.

Additional Notes / Tips

  • Use overnight oats for a creamier texture.
  • Swap maple syrup with dates for natural sweetness.
  • Sprinkle cinnamon on top for a warm, cozy kick.
  • Chill coffee well to avoid a watered-down taste.
  • Freeze banana chunks beforehand for a thicker smoothie.
